Essential Settings for HTC Android 6.x Guide

These settings must be properly configured to keep the application working.

Battery Setting

  1. Setting > Power > Power Save Mode
    Set to “OFF”
  2. Setting > Power > Advanced Power Save Mode
    Set to “OFF”
  3. Setting > Power > Battery optimization > System Service > Not Optimize
    Set to “ON”

Background App Setting

HTC Security Assistant > Auto Acceleration > Manage Skipping Applications > System  Service
Set to “ON“

Other Settings

No need to change these settings by default. But they will affect the application functions if changed by user.

Data Usage

HTC Security Assistant > All > Rights Management > Network control > Manage WLAN and mobile data use of apps > System Service
Set to “ON“

App Setting

  1. Setting > Security > Rights Management > System Service
    Set to “ON”
  2. Security Assistant > Setting Management > Application Permissions > System  Service
    Set to “ON”
  3. HTC Security Assistant > Settings > Intelligent Acceleration
    Set to “OFF”
